Near the low end of the 27–95 tok/s/user interactivity band, at 44 tok/s/user on MiniMax M2.5/M2.7: GB200 NVL72 runs 5835 tok/s/GPU at $0.11/M tokens, MI300X runs 1249 at $0.25/M. GB200 NVL72 is 138% cheaper per token; GB200 NVL72 delivers 367% more tok/s/GPU.
Setting 61 tok/s/user as the target on MiniMax M2.5/M2.7, GB200 NVL72 produces 3207 tok/s/GPU ($0.19 per million tokens) and MI300X produces 779 ($0.40). GB200 NVL72 is 111% cheaper per token; GB200 NVL72 delivers 312% more tok/s/GPU.
At 78 tok/s/user interactivity on MiniMax M2.5/M2.7, GB200 NVL72 delivers 1320 tok/s/GPU at $0.48 per million tokens; MI300X delivers 412 tok/s/GPU at $0.75. GB200 NVL72 is 55% cheaper per token; GB200 NVL72 delivers 220% more tok/s/GPU at this point.
